The Claim
In healthy young men, performing 300 maximal eccentric quadriceps contractions immediately before 7 days of unilateral leg immobilization is associated with higher daily myofibrillar protein synthesis (MyoPS) rates during the first 2 days of disuse compared to no prior exercise, with MyoPS rates 48% greater in the exercised leg (2.57 ± 0.22 vs. 1.89 ± 0.21%·day⁻¹), suggesting that prior muscle-damaging exercise transiently elevates protein synthesis during early disuse.

If young, healthy guys do a tough leg workout right before having one leg immobilized for a week, their muscles in that leg keep building protein faster for the first couple of days compared to if they didn’t exercise first.
